Full Job Description
  • Evaluate and treat patients for swallowing disorders and communication/ cognitive impairments, utilizing a variety of evidenced based therapeutic techniques
  • Establish treatment goals, as well as develop and implement appropriate Speech Pathology treatment programs based upon a full clinical evaluation
  • Provide rehabilitative services to patients under specific medical orders as part of a coordinated team.
  • Participate in clinical conferences to share and coordinate the plan of care for patients
  • Treat residents one on one so each patient gets individualized attention through private treatment sessions with a functional based treatment approach
